Well, the main reason we aren't updating our current ENB's to 0.119 is because the only effect it adds compared to 0.113 is the SkyLighting which neither Kyo or I are crazy about. Not using it in our 0.119 wip either. Personal preference of course but in our opinion the little it adds isn't nearly worth the cost to performance. Not to mention we don't really care for the look of the SkyLighting anyway. 0.119 is great for the interior / exterior nightime separation but 0.113 still rocks on it's own. So unless you are looking to just add the SkyLighting feature to an existing 0.113 configuration or have a little more control over the settings for interior / exterior it really isn't worth doing to be completely honest with you. Actually I have to admit this setting I always left to true and took on faith that the Mighty Russian knows best for this one. I felt a little silly asking my buddies about EXACTLY what bugs it fixes and was relieved and amused when the concensus was "Uh, you know, I'm not quite sure but Boris knows best. Something to do with adding ENB to Skyrim". Ok, so who didn't know that? :D One brave soul even marched straight into the lions den, at the risk of being horrifically scarred for life, beaten, abused, and possible insults against the very woman who bore him. Thankfully either Boris was in a good mood or was already busy relentlessly ridiculing another poor victims intelligence or lack thereof. He made it back with this answer. Slightly edited from "BorisSpeak" for easier understanding. ;) Rendering issues often occur when you introduce a binary that a game will not execute, like the ENBSeries binary. Generally speaking, these are crash bugs, engine bugs, and system allocation bugs (like Skyrim being a CPU-intensive game, therefore ENBSeries rectifies that by pushing some rendering onto the GPU, balancing things out). So basically what we already knew. Bugs related to the addition of the ENBSeries binary. Unless I find someone who has already done this, the only way to find out EXACTLY which bugs the FixGameBugs actually eliminate is to decompile the binary. And to be honest, right now we are all too busy (LOVE 0.119 :D) and not curious enough to go through that ordeal at the moment. I will keep trying to find a more detailed answer but for now this is all any of us know. So my advice is to trust in the Almighty Russian and keep this set to true. Boris knows best. ;)

Skyrim character creation menu & FOV
Staind716 replied to carlos3lance's question in General Skyrim LE Support
Very common issue with DOF. The solution is simple. Just hit Shift+F12 to disable while creating your character and again to reenable when you are done. ;) Also a good little trick if you encounter long loading times as well. :) Edit: And yes Farlo, I know that's basically the same thing you said.
